Beyond scheduled tasks: what “no coding required” really means
The phrase “no coding required” is more than just a marketing slogan; it signifies a profound change in user interaction. Traditional smart home systems often demand a certain level of technical fluency, requiring users to set up intricate “if-then” scenarios or understand API integrations. Autonomous AI housekeepers eliminate this barrier entirely. They leverage advanced machine learning, natural language processing, and sensor fusion to interpret your environment and intentions. Instead of programming, you interact through natural voice commands, gestures, or simply by living your life. The AI observes patterns, identifies anomalies, and learns your routines over time – when you wake up, when you arrive home, your preferred lighting for reading, or the optimal temperature for sleep. It’s about a symbiotic relationship where your home adapts to you, rather than you adapting to your home’s settings. The following table highlights the contrast:
| Feature | Traditional smart home interaction | Autonomous AI housekeeper interaction |
|---|---|---|
| Climate control | Schedule AC for 72°F at 6 PM daily. | AI learns preferred comfort zones, adjusts based on occupancy, external weather, and time of day. |
| Lighting management | Set specific light scenes or schedules (e.g., “dim lights to 40% after 9 PM”). | AI optimizes lighting dynamically for activity, time, and natural light availability; responds to mood. |
| Security monitoring | Manual arming/disarming, receives alerts, reviews footage. | AI learns family members’ presence, monitors for unusual activity, identifies potential threats, manages access. |
| Entertainment | Manually select music, TV shows, or adjust volume. | AI suggests content based on preferences, time of day, and current mood; manages multi-room audio/video. |

The benefits and future landscape
The advantages of autonomous AI housekeepers are multifaceted. Firstly, they offer unparalleled convenience and efficiency, reclaiming hours spent on managing home systems. This translates to significant time savings and a reduction in mental load. Secondly, they promote energy efficiency by intelligently optimizing climate control, lighting, and appliance usage based on actual need, leading to lower utility bills and a smaller carbon footprint. Thirdly, these systems enhance accessibility for individuals with mobility challenges or those who simply prefer a more hands-off approach to home management. The future promises even deeper integration, with AI housekeepers potentially managing everything from personalized dietary suggestions based on fridge contents to predictive maintenance for home appliances. Ethical considerations around data privacy and security will naturally evolve alongside the technology, ensuring that these powerful systems serve homeowners responsibly.
